Find the complement and supplement of the given angles 42°

Answer: complement = 48°, supplement = 138°

Step-by-step explanation:

complement means the sum of the angles = 90°

42° + x = 90°

-42°       -42°

          x = 48°

supplement means the sum of the angles = 180°

42° + x = 180°

-42°         -42°

          x = 138°
